## Formula sandbox tuning

User-supplied formulas in Gridmoor execute inside a restricted interpreter with hard ceilings on time, memory, and call depth. Reviewers should confirm any change to these ceilings is justified in the PR description, since raising them widens the abuse surface. Defaults were chosen from production traces. The current limits are as follows.

limits module of tafog-fawip:
WEIGHTS = {
    "julix": 57,
    "lamys": 992,
    "kasvan": 209,
    "quenok": 750,
    "alddor": 259,
    "oliath": 1009,
    "wenix": 815,
}

// Support folks: this module renders the little waveform thumbnails in
// the Chordelia player. If customers report blurry or laggy previews,
// it's almost always one of the constants below — sample stride too
// coarse, or the render cache too small. Don't guess; check with the
// audio team before editing. The values we ship today are listed here.

tuning table, hafog-bahaf:
QUOTAS = {
    "praion": 144,
    "briax": 906,
    "silwyn": 451,
}

Facilities Ticket — Cleaning Crew Access, Brindle Annex

For new starters handling evening lock-up: the Sorano Cleaning crew arrives nightly at 21:30 via the annex side door. Check their rota sheet, note arrival in the log, and ensure the storeroom is relocked afterward. To let them through the side door, enter the access code below.

badge for yaweg-hafog: bdg-GX-6

## Hermetic build migration

Phase 2 moves the Larkspin compiler targets to the Bramblebuild sandbox. No network access at build time; all deps come from the pinned vendor snapshot. Reject any change reintroducing host toolchain paths. Verify output digests match the baseline before approving. The sandbox runs with the configuration shown below.

service settings:
HOLDOR_PIN=6477
HOLDOR_METRICS_HOST=metrics.holdor.nelvrocorp.corp
HOLDOR_LOG_LEVEL=error
HOLDOR_TENANT=noviel